A look at some of the key business events and economic indicators upcoming this week:Tyson FoodsTyson Foods reports its fourth quarter earnings Monday. Tyson, one of the world’s largest meat processors, is expected to report its profit fell for a second-straight quarter to $1.71 a share, according to analysts surveyed by FactSet.
